一次性通过2025年数据库考试的秘诀
姓名:____________________
一、单项选择题(每题2分,共10题)
1.数据库管理系统的核心是()。
A.数据库设计
B.数据库模型
C.数据库查询
D.数据库维护
2.下列哪一项不是数据库系统的特点?()
A.数据冗余度低
B.数据共享性高
C.数据独立性低
D.数据完整性高
3.关系模型的数据结构是()。
A.层次结构
B.网状结构
C.层次/网状结构
D.表结构
4.下列哪个选项是SQL语言的核心功能?()
A.数据查询
B.数据定义
C.数据操作
D.数据控制
5.下列关于视图的描述,错误的是()。
A.视图是一个虚拟表
B.视图可以包含多个基本表
C.视图可以提高查询效率
D.视图可以更新数据
6.下列哪个SQL语句用于创建索引?()
A.CREATEINDEX
B.INSERTINDEX
C.INDEXCREATE
D.ADDINDEX
7.在数据库中,外键约束用于()。
A.保证数据的完整性
B.确保数据的安全性
C.限制数据的访问
D.提高查询效率
8.下列关于触发器的描述,错误的是()。
A.触发器可以执行多个操作
B.触发器在插入、删除或更新数据时触发
C.触发器可以访问触发事件前的数据
D.触发器只能由数据库管理员创建
9.下列关于存储过程的说法,正确的是()。
A.存储过程是存储在数据库中的SQL语句集合
B.存储过程可以提高数据查询效率
C.存储过程只能由数据库管理员创建
D.存储过程不支持参数传递
10.下列关于数据库备份的说法,错误的是()。
A.备份可以保护数据免受丢失或损坏
B.备份可以提高数据库的性能
C.备份可以降低数据恢复的时间
D.备份可以减少数据冗余
二、多项选择题(每题3分,共10题)
1.数据库系统的组成包括()。
A.数据库
B.数据库管理系统
C.应用程序
D.数据库管理员
E.硬件设备
2.下列关于数据模型的描述,正确的有()。
A.数据模型是数据库系统的核心
B.数据模型用于描述数据之间的关系
C.数据模型是数据库设计的依据
D.数据模型与数据库管理系统无关
E.数据模型用于实现数据的存储和管理
3.下列关于关系代数的运算,正确的有()。
A.选择
B.投影
C.并
D.差
E.连接
4.SQL语言的功能包括()。
A.数据定义
B.数据查询
C.数据操纵
D.数据控制
E.数据备份
5.下列关于视图的优点的描述,正确的有()。
A.提高数据安全性
B.简化复杂查询
C.提高数据独立性
D.提高数据共享性
E.减少数据冗余
6.在数据库设计中,常见的范式有()。
A.第一范式
B.第二范式
C.第三范式
D.第四范式
E.第五范式
7.下列关于触发器的应用场景,正确的有()。
A.实现数据一致性
B.自动执行数据校验
C.实现复杂的业务逻辑
D.提高数据查询效率
E.简化数据操作流程
8.存储过程的特点包括()。
A.提高代码重用性
B.提高数据安全性
C.提高数据库性能
D.简化数据库维护
E.支持参数传递
9.数据库备份的类型包括()。
A.完全备份
B.差异备份
C.增量备份
D.定期备份
E.按需备份
10.下列关于数据库安全的说法,正确的有()。
A.数据库安全包括物理安全和逻辑安全
B.数据库安全包括数据安全和访问控制
C.数据库安全包括数据备份和数据恢复
D.数据库安全包括数据库加密和数据脱密
E.数据库安全包括网络安全和系统安全
三、判断题(每题2分,共10题)
1.数据库系统是指由数据库及其管理软件组成的系统。()
2.在数据库中,实体集与实体集之间的关系可以是多对多的关系。()
3.SQL语言支持事务处理,确保了数据的一致性。()
4.视图中的数据是物理存储在数据库中的。()
5.第二范式要求表中的所有字段都是主属性。()
6.触发器只能响应数据表上的INSERT、UPDATE和DELETE操作。()
7.存储过程只能由数据库管理员调用。()
8.数据库备份可以恢复到任何时刻的状态。()
9.数据库的安全性主要是指保护数据不被非法访问。()
10.在数据库中,数据的完整性是指数据的正确性和一致性。()
四、简答题(每题5分,共6题)
1.简述数据库系统的三级模式及其相互关系。
2.解释什么是数据库的规范化,并简要说明第一范式、第二范式和第三范式的主要区别。
3.列举三种常见的数据库查询操作